Government Official Arrested with Undeclared Cash at Biratnagar Airport
english.ratopati.com · Fri Jul 24 06:07:51 GMT 2026

Biratnagar. A chief of a government office has been arrested with undeclared cash from Biratnagar Airport. On August 19, the program implementation unit chief of the President Chure Terai Madhesh Conservation Development Committee, Morang, Deputy Secretary Mikmar Tamang, was taken into police custody with Rs 665,000 in cash.
Tamang, a resident of Bhimeshwor Municipality-9, Dolakha, was preparing to fly from Biratnagar to Kathmandu on a Buddha Air flight. During regular security checks at the airport, Rs 665,000, consisting of 515 notes of Rs 1,000 denomination and 300 notes of Rs 500 denomination, was found hidden inside a black bag Tamang was carrying. When questioned about the legal source of the amount, he could not provide a satisfactory answer, leading the airport police security guard to take him into custody.
